what is copyrighted software? | Software that is legally protected against copying or being used without paying for it. |
What is Public Domain software? | non copyrighted software that anyone may copy or use without charge. |
What is shareware? | Copyrighted software that may be tried without expense but requires payment if you decide to use it. |
What is freeware? | software on the web that is freely available but retains a copyright? |
Some examples of freeware include: | Mozilla firefox, adobe flash palyer, quick time player. |
